Ukrainian wheat stocks fell by 1.1 MMT in March 2017

Wheat stocks of this year amounted to 4.98 MMT (in March). This volume corresponds to 32% of the total volume of grain stocks of Ukrainian enterprises. Thus, during March 2017, 1.07 MMT of wheat were used. Out of these, 1.05 MMT were exported.

The largest grain reserves at the reporting date were located in Odessa (530.1 KMT), Mykolaiv (450.9 KMT) and Vinnytsia regions (355.3 KMT). At the same time, 44.6 KMT of wheat were in Lviv region, 44.6 KMT in Chernivtsy and only 1.3 KMT in Transcarpathian regions.

In general, the volumes of stored wheat as of the beginning of April of this year decreased by 20.7% compared to the corresponding date of the previous year. The reason for this situation is, first of all, a smaller volume of domestic supply due to a reduction in gross wheat harvest over the past two years because of harvest areas decrease as well as active grain shipments to the foreign markets. In total, since the beginning of MY 2016/17, 14.62 MMT of wheat were shipped to the foreign markets, which exceeds the results of the same period last season by 16%.

It is worth to mention that according to ProAgro, the wheat crop in MY 2016/17 is estimated at 26.06 MMT against 26.53 MMT in the previous season. In the next MY 2017/18 gross harvest of grain is expected by at the level of 26.3-26.4 MMT.
